Quick take

FLORIDAYS WOODFIRE GRILL & BAR in BRADENTON currently holds an InspectFL Health Score of 74.9 out of 100 — a C grade — a noticeable pattern of violations across recent inspections. This restaurant has 2 inspections on record from Florida DBPR, with the most recent inspection on February 17, 2026. Across those visits, inspectors documented 23 total violations — 4 critical, 5 major, 14 minor.

  • Inspection Completed - No Further Action
  • [10-01-5] In-use utensil in non-time/temperature control for safety food not stored with handle above top of food within a closed container. Observed handle of flour scoop in the flour. Operator moved handle above product.
  • [13-07-4] Employee wearing jewelry other than a plain ring on their hands/arms while preparing food. Observed employee engaged in food preparation wearing a watch. Employee removed watch.
  • [21-08-4] Wiping cloth quaternary ammonium compound sanitizing solution not at proper minimum strength. Observed quaternary wiping cloth sanitizer to low. Operator changed quaternary sanitizer bucket. Quaternary sanitizer bucket now at 200ppm
  • [22-02-4] Food-contact surface soiled with food debris, mold-like substance or slime. Observed interior of soda gun with soil and slime. Operator cleaned gun.
  • [41-10-4] Toxic substance/chemical improperly stored. Observed grill cleaner on food preparation table next to hand wash sink . Operator removed cleaner.
  • [05-09-4] No conspicuously located ambient air temperature thermometer in holding unit. Observed no ambient thermometer in single door make station on cook line across from grill. Operator replaced thermometer.
  • [23-03-4] Nonfood-contact surface soiled with grease, food debris, dirt, slime or dust. Observed underneath side of soda dispenser with black mold like substance. Employee was in the process of cleaning area.
  • [31A-11-4] Handwash sink used for purposes other than handwashing. Observed hand wash sink in bar area being used as a dump sink. Operator removed strainer.
  • [36-34-5] Ceiling/ceiling tiles/vents soiled with accumulated food debris, grease, dust, or mold-like substance. Observed ceiling tiles on cook line across from grill with excess dust and soil.
  • [42-01-4] Wet mop not stored in a manner to allow the mop to dry. Observed wet mops not hung to dry. Operator hung mops.
  • [08A-05-6] Raw animal food stored over/not properly separated from ready-to-eat food. Observed raw beef over cooked chicken wings in 4 drawer reach-in cooler on cook line. Operator switched products around.
